Capital Goods Scheme
About
The Capital Goods Scheme (CGS), a visionary government initiative designed to propel the capital goods industry forward by offering a range of enticing benefits.
With a primary objective of stimulating domestic manufacturing, the CGS aims to foster investment, fortify technological capabilities, and ultimately contribute to robust economic growth.
The Capital Goods Scheme (CGS) represents a bold and visionary approach to empower the capital goods industry. By enhancing domestic manufacturing,encouraging investment, nurturing technological innovation, and fostering skill development, the scheme creates a thriving ecosystem that contributes to sustainable economic growth.
Phase I
Program Outlay
Rs. 995.96 Cr
Budgetary Support
Rs 631.22 Cr
Project Approved
33
View Projects
Phase II
Program Outlay
Rs. 1207 Cr
Budgetary Support
Rs 975 Cr
Project Approved
27
